Low-Code Development Platform: An All-in-One Approach to Software Development     

Trending on Techiexpert

- Advertisement -

Over the last twenty years, the variety of tools and technologies in IT has evolved.  Previously,  IT teams relied on highly specialized employees,  such as DBAs who knew AS/400 or directors who could list COBOL as a native language. But now, IT departments no longer manage homogeneous stacks but diverse, complex software environments.

IT alone can’t drive modern organizations’ digital transformation in today’s digital era. Businesses can’t rely solely on custom scripts, and few developers have the expertise to keep up with the rapid pace of modern digital transformation. We need an application development platform where code is abstracted away, and every professional without specialized knowledge runs the tool or technology.

Why not let app developers think about the experience they want to deliver rather than worrying about how they’ll build it?

This blog will explore low-code development platform that enable IT people to quickly assemble, build, and deploy business applications tailored to their organizations’ needs without researching, writing, and testing new scripts. 

How Has Low-Code Technology Evolved?

Low code is an all-in-one platform for developing anything from IT processes to business software. Empowering developers with low-code app development, building reliable, cross-platform business applications easily while keeping experts in their specific business domains to innovate, solve challenges, and enhance customer offerings.

Technical/non-technical developers build apps easily and across multiple digital touchpoints, from mobile to wearables to IoT devices, unlocking the potential of every employee in your organization. While citizen developers create apps with low-code platforms easily, professional developers use them to  accelerate complex tasks.

That said, there are a few features that low-code application platform have in common to build and deploy apps, as follows:

Simplifies Complex Coding using Low-code API Integration

The low-code development platform, as a part of an integrated development environment,  provides a set of predefined and customizable APIs that teams can directly integrate into proprietary applications and build software applications without requiring specialized coding developers. The platform handles all the complexity of SDLC, you only need a basic understanding of how APIs work.

Reduces Dependency with Drag-and-drop Workflow

Application developers can automate the development process using a low-code platform’s drag and drop interface and graphical user interface (GUI), eliminating dependencies on traditional computer programming approaches.

Delivery on time with Workflow Testing Facilities

Low-code platforms are equipped to manage an application’s entire SDLC, from development and testing to deployment and maintenance with robust workflow automation capabilities. Testers can easily automate tests using visual models, even allowing non-technical users to participate in test automation. You can easily track an application’s status, versioning, and updates with a low-code platform.

Why is an All-in-One Low-Code Platform Essential for Modern Software Development?

A low-code environment integrates complex backend systems and adds innovative experiences  seamlessly on a single platform for modern software development. Businesses accelerate app delivery without  avoiding steep learning curves, shadow IT risks, lack of governance, technical debt, cybersecurity or compliance concerns.

According to the market and research report, the global low-code development platform market is predicted to generate a revenue of $187.0 billion by 2030. With low-code platforms, modern IT enterprises reduce the application development  complexity, cost, and delivery time. This eliminates the need for costly IT resources that can be better utilized for the business’s more strategic priorities. Low-code development tools facilitate rapid application creation through user-friendly interfaces, reducing the need for extensive coding knowledge and enabling organizations to innovate faster by streamlining development processes.

Highlights of the role of the low-code platform in the app development cycle :

  • Offer one unified platform for all skill sets to build apps under one infrastructure, license, governance model and security standard.
  • Promotes strong collaboration between business users and IT, where users can independently solve their digital challenges.
  • Reach users wherever they live digitally across any device, progressive web apps (PWAs), native mobile apps, and even wearables and kiosks, all on a single code base.
  • Combine the speed and ease of low-code application development platform with enterprise backend services and integration capabilities to accelerate app development.
  • Modernize legacy applications to evolve, extend, and even replace existing apps with reduced time, complexity, and cost by avoiding complete rewrites and disjointed off-the-shelf solutions.

How to Choose the Right Low-Code Platform for Your Business?

Low-code application platform offers secure, governed and flexible software apps. When choosing a low-code platform, check on ease of adoption and a convincing experience that gets users up to speed quickly. For example, if the number of development requests consistently increases, you should adopt a low-code platform to prevent an IT backlog. By allowing citizen developers to create their own applications, these platforms reduce the number of app requests placed on the development team, enabling them to focus on more complex tasks while still allowing for customization and iteration on the applications developed by non-technical users. Similarly, if you anticipate a period when developers must consistently add capabilities to an application to meet rising demands, low-code platforms will be a perfect fit.

Businesses should consider whether platform capabilities match their business needs. You can compare the use cases of the framework according to your business needs.

Businesses should also check for the following features in a low-code development platform:

  • Performance-wise, it has a responsive user experience
  • Need click to build apps and workflows with drag-and-drop tools
  • It should be low code  which extends to custom code
  • Integration with your data and systems
  • Security, privacy, and governance controls
  • AI and low-code automation tools to streamline complex workflows quickly
  • Should support for common third-party development

Conclusion

Software applications built primarily on native code often prove challenging to change or update over time. You must pivot quickly to stay updated with changing market demands without breaking much code. Low-code software development platforms empower users with varying levels of technical expertise to innovate and create the software experiences they need with minimum coding experience.

Recent Stories

Related Articles